What is Nepal's lowest geographical point?

Kechana Kalan in Jhapa district is Nepal's lowest point, at an elevation of 60 meters above sea level.

What is the highest and lowest elevations in Ohio?

Ohio's highest elevation point is Campbell Hill and is 1,549 feet (472 meters) above sea level. Ohio's lowest elevation point is the Ohio River at the Indiana state border and is 455 feet (139 meters) above sea level

What is the lowest point in Indiana and height?

The lowest point in Indiana is 320 feet above sea level, where the Wabash River flows into the Ohio River, in Posey County.


What is the lowest elivation of Illinois?

Illinois's lowest point is the junction of the Mississippi and Ohio Rivers at 280 feet (85 meters) above sea level

What is the highest and lowest point in Paraguay?

The highest point in Paraguay is Cerro Tres Kandú, which reaches an elevation of approximately 742 meters (2,438 feet) above sea level, located in the northeastern part of the country. The lowest point is the Paraguay River, which runs through the country and has varying elevations, but generally, the river's level is considered the lowest geographical point in Paraguay.
